As discussed over, all dietitians are nutritionists but not all nutritional experts have the credentials and credentials to be called dietitians.

This indicates specifically the very same point as Registered Dietitian (RD), a term that has actually remained in use for a long time. All RDs are RDNs but some select to call themselves that and some do not. Even more complicating issues are license requirements. While accreditation to become an RD or RDN is regulated by the Academy of Nutrition and Dietetics a national company licensure is managed by private states.

In order to offer medical nutrition treatment and qualify as carriers for insurer, a dietitian needs to be accredited by the state. According to the Bureau of Labor Data, the demand for dietitians and nutritionists is expected to enhance by 20% in between 2010 and 2020 this is a much faster growth price than the standard for all professions.

Bureau of Labor Data puts dietitians and nutritional experts in the exact same category and claims they earn a average yearly salary of $69,680. However there is a variety in salaries, with the lower 10% around $44,910 and the top 10% around $98,830, according to the BLS. Nutritional expert and dietitian duties are expected to expand 6.6% via 2032, according to the BLS.

Nutritionist advice regarding nutrition's influence on wellness. They aid people adopt much healthier methods of consuming and create personalized strategies based upon goals. Their services include dietary assessment and therapy, dish preparation and developing healthy and balanced eating programs. Some have formal education and learning and credentials, others may have more basic certifications. The area is less regulated than diet professionals; for this reason, nutritional experts' levels of competence and certifications can differ.
